Effects Of Tamoxifen On Mitochondrial Nos Activity: Alteration In The Intramitochondrial Ca2+ Homeostasis, Sandeep S. Joshi Jan 2005

Effects Of Tamoxifen On Mitochondrial Nos Activity: Alteration In The Intramitochondrial Ca2+ Homeostasis, Sandeep S. Joshi

Theses, Dissertations and Capstones

Tamoxifen (Tam) is an anticancer drug that induces oxidative stress and apoptosis via mitochondria- and nitric oxide (NO)-dependent pathways. Here, we report that therapeutic concentrations of Tam stimulate the mitochondrial NO synthase (mtNOS) activity of isolated rat liver mitochondria by increasing the intramitochondrial ionized Ca2+ concentration ([Ca2+]m). Tam decreases transmembrane potential (∆ψ) due to increased [Ca2+]m that neutralizes the negative charges of the inner mitochondrial membrane. Thus, the present study reports a novel mechanism for the widely used anti- caner drug, Tam.
